Key Responsibilities of Human Factors Experts
Human Factors professionals
examine how people interact with technology, devices, and workspaces to improve usability, performance, and safety. Their work involves:
✅ Human Behavior Analysis – Studying user habits and perception to enhance system design.
✅ Ergonomics & Workplace Safety – Creating physical environments that reduce fatigue and improve productivity.
✅ UX & UI Optimization – Improving the responsiveness of software platforms, applications, and interfaces.
✅ User-Centered Testing – Conducting usability tests to refine designs.
✅ Risk Assessment – Identifying potential human errors and developing preventive measures in sensitive sectors such as hospitals and air travel.
Key Industries for Human Factors Professionals
Human Factors experts play a role in different professional fields, focusing on that solutions are structured with human capabilities and limitations as a core focus.
???? Medical Industry – Improving how doctors and nurses interact with technology, streamlining healthcare processes, and reducing human error in medical institutions.
???? Air Travel Safety – Creating cockpit controls, pilot training programs, and flight safety protocols to minimize flight risks.
???? Car Manufacturing – Developing driver-friendly interfaces, reducing accidents, and creating user-friendly systems.
???? Software Development – Optimizing software, apps, and digital products for maximum usability.
???? Industrial Design – Creating ergonomic workstations, reducing physical strain, and enhancing operational processes.
